#D657D0 Color

#D657D0 is rgb(214, 87, 208) in RGB, hsl(303, 61%, 59%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 59%, 3%, 16%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Deep Fuchsia (#C154C1),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 7.99.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

What #D657D0 Is Called

Most hex codes have no name: there are 16.7 million of them and a few thousand registered names. These are the named colors nearest to #D657D0, ordered by CIE76 distance in CIELAB. Anything under about ΔE 2 is a difference most people cannot see.

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#D657D0 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

How #D657D0 Looks with Color Vision Deficiency

Simulated with the Viénot, Brettel & Mollon LMS projection model. Anomalous types are rendered as partial versions of the matching dichromacy, which is an approximation rather than a per-person clinical model.

#D657D0 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#D657D0?

#D657D0 is a mid-tone pink — rgb(214, 87, 208) in RGB and hsl(303, 61%, 59%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Deep Fuchsia (#C154C1),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 7.99.

What is the RGB value of #D657D0?

#D657D0 is rgb(214, 87, 208) — red 214, green 87, and blue 208 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#D657D0?

#D657D0 conver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 59%, 3%, 16%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#D657D0 be black or white?

Black text is the more readable choice. #D657D0 scores 3.42:1 against white and 6.13: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#D657D0 as a CSS color keyword?

No. #D657D0 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is orchid (#DA70D6) at a CIE76 distance of 11.34, which is visibly different.
